I also remember visiting the signal box to see my grandfather, Alf Carter. It was a great adventure to see inside with all the huge levers. There was a good view over the surrounding area. My grandfather was also a keen gardener and when he retired he still used to ride his push bike around Wickford to do other people’s gardens for them, for a small fee. He also did the garden out at Battlesbridge of Mr Harvey Hodgson, a local builder and business man.

My sister married Geoff Carter whose father Alf(?) Carter was the main signal man in this box for many years. I can remember visiting the signal box in the 1950s as a child. He lived in Athelstan Gardens, Wickford.
